The health insurers are not anti-"reform" | Washington Examiner: "The most pervasive and most thoroughly false bit of disinformation circulating about health care 'reform' legislation is the assertion that opponents of Democratic legislation are on the side of the drug maker and the health insurers.

The truth is very far from that.

Here's a briefing on the policy front:

First, 'pro-reform' doesn't mean anything. Currently, there are at least four different 'reform' bills before the House and Senate, and they all share some common provisions and also have differences. They also all differ from what Barack Obama advocated on the campaign trail."
